State Street Corporation, established in 1792 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the oldest financial institutions in the United States and a major player in the global asset management and custody banking sectors. Primarily known for its custodial services, it safeguards assets for institutional investors, managing trillions of dollars through its State Street Global Advisors (SSGA) division, which is renowned for launching the first U.S. exchange-traded fund (ETF), the S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Y), in 1993. The company provides a range of services including investment management, research, trading, and data analytics, catering mostly to institutional clients like pension funds, endowments, and mutual funds. With a focus on financial infrastructure and innovation, State Street has positioned itself as a key backbone in the global investment ecosystem.

State Street's Q3 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2013, State Street held 3,700 positions worth $812B, up 5.8% from $767B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

State Street's Q3 2013 filing shows 126 new, 1,814 increased, 1,520 reduced and 72 closed positions. Its largest new stake was News Corp Class A: 19,075,767 shares worth $306M. The largest sale was SPRINT CORP FON COM, an estimated $829M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 15%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
